ALEKS, which stands for Assessment and Learning in Knowledge Spaces, was created in 1993 by a team of mathematicians, computer scientists, and cognitive scientists at the University of California, Irvine. The goal of ALEKS was to develop an innovative and personalized learning platform that could provide individualized instruction and assessment in various subjects, with a particular focus on mathematics.
Since its creation, ALEKS has evolved and expanded to cover a wide range of subjects beyond mathematics, including science, business, and language arts. The platform utilizes artificial intelligence and adaptive questioning to assess a student’s knowledge and tailor the learning experience accordingly. This personalized approach allows students to focus on areas where they need improvement, while also providing challenges for those who are more advanced.
